The Saturday auction presents the Estates of Charles Chevalier, Mt. Clemens, and Nellie Rhodes of Harbortown, Detroit; property from the Collection of Victor Tahill; and a collection of Georg Jensen and Buccellati sterling from a private Ann Arbor lady including an impressive pair of Georg Jensen Pomegranate candelabra, a Pyramid coffee set, a Blossom gravy boat, as well as footed bowls, sauce bowls, flatware, and goblets. Russian silver and enamel objet de vertu and icons; bronze sculptures by Evgeni Lanceray, Eugene Marioton, Ernest Guilbert, and after Grachev; antique oil paintings; and contemporary lithographs by Calder and Erte. Furniture highlights include antique French fauteuils and vitrines, a Yamaha piano with Disklavier, and a Saarinen birch and aluminum bedroom set. Additionally, Chinese blue and white porcelains; Japanese ivory netsuke; a Steuben gold aurene vase; Hideaki Miyamura and other studio pottery; French champlevé mantel clock; sterling flatware sets by Towle, International, and Reed & Barton; a circa 1880 Bru bisque Bebe doll; Lladro figures; Steuben, Val St. Lambert and Waterford crystal; designer bags by Judith Leiber, Louis Vuitton and Gucci; as well as fine jewelry and a variety of oriental rugs from semi antique to modern.
